In terms of cleansing up stay drums, few instruments divide opinion fairly like a gate.

Ask ten mixers what their favorite drum gate is and you’ll get ten passionate solutions, often adopted by a narrative about hi-hat bleed, unusable tom mics, or that one snare observe that just about ruined a combination.

Just a few months in the past, we requested precisely that query throughout YouTube, Fb, Instagram, e-mail, the academy, and the scholars web page. What’s your favorite plugin for gating drums? The consequence was clear. Sonnox Oxford Drum Gate got here out on prime. Nonetheless, there have been so many robust strategies for different favourites that it felt solely honest to place the highest contenders face to face and see what actually occurs in a correct combine state of affairs.

So that’s precisely what we did.

 

Relatively than testing these plugins on a superbly recorded, surgically remoted fashionable drum package, I needed to make life tough. The observe we used, by our good mates The Final Internationale, is a much more life like problem for many people. This package was recorded with simply 5 microphones, mono kick, mono snare, mono overhead, mono room, and a trash mic. No stereo imaging, no shut tom mics, loads of bleed, and many hi-hat pouring into the snare mic.

In different phrases, precisely the form of session the place a drum gate really has to earn its preserve.

The 5 Drum Gates within the Shootout

The 5 plugins we examined had been:

Sonnox Oxford Drum Gate A drum-specific gate with clever transient detection, ghost be aware preservation, pure decay dealing with, and in-built time alignment.

FabFilter Professional-G Not particularly designed for drums, nevertheless extraordinarily versatile, very clear, and full of detailed visible suggestions and sidechain management.

SSL X-Gate A easy, punchy, SSL-style gate with a traditional workflow and a really reasonably priced price ticket.

Sonible sensible:gate An AI-assisted gate designed to separate hits from bleed in messier recordings the place conventional gating can wrestle.

Black Salt Audio Silencer A stripped again, ultra-fast drum cleanup software with a contemporary workflow and minimal setup.

Every one had one thing going for it. The actual query was which one dealt with this tough 5 mic drum recording one of the best with out destroying the texture of the package.

Why This Check Really Issues

Quite a lot of drum gate demos use pristine recordings. There may be nothing unsuitable with that, nevertheless it doesn’t all the time inform you a lot about how a plugin will behave when the session will get messy.

Most of us aren’t all the time mixing completely remoted kick and snare tracks with devoted tom mics and superbly managed cymbals. Generally you’re coping with a mono overhead carrying the toms, room mic splash, and sufficient hi-hat bleed to begin its personal band.

That’s the place a drum gate both turns into a lifesaver or a supply of recent issues.

The objective right here was not merely to make the drums tighter. It was to protect physique, assault, and decay, whereas lowering undesirable bleed sufficient that compression, EQ, and atmosphere might be utilized with out the entire package turning right into a fizzy, phasey mess.

1. Sonnox Oxford Drum Gate, Nonetheless the One to Beat

It didn’t take lengthy to listen to why Oxford Drum Gate gained the viewers ballot.

On kick and snare, it instantly felt pure. It was quick to arrange, it let me select the supply kind, detect the instrument correctly, and dial in decay with out dropping the burden of the drum. Most significantly, it removed bleed whereas nonetheless preserving the physique of the sound.

That physique turned out to be an enormous a part of this entire shootout.

Quite a lot of gates can cut back bleed. The actual trick is doing it with out making the drum really feel smaller, thinner, or overly processed. Oxford stored the snare sounding like the unique snare. The kick nonetheless had increase and assault. Ghost notes and pure maintain felt intact.

Nonetheless, what actually pushed it forward was not simply the gating.

Oxford Drum Gate additionally allowed me to make use of alignment solely on the overhead, room, and trash mic. That meant I may section align the entire package whereas cleansing up the shut mics. As soon as every thing was working collectively, the low finish obtained greater, the snare had extra physique, and the entire package felt extra highly effective and extra cohesive.

That additional performance is what made it very tough for the others to beat. On gating alone, a number of the competitors obtained impressively shut. As soon as time alignment entered the image, Oxford pulled forward.

 

2. FabFilter Professional-G, Extremely Shut

If Oxford had the sting total, FabFilter Professional-G was the closest challenger.

This was notably attention-grabbing as a result of Professional-G isn’t marketed as a drum-specific software in the identical method. Nonetheless, it carried out extraordinarily nicely, particularly on kick and snare. It was clear, exact, and versatile. With cautious tweaking, it obtained very near the Oxford on pure gating duties.

On the kick, Professional-G did a fantastic job controlling bleed whereas preserving sufficient weight to stay musical. On the snare, it additionally obtained shut, particularly as soon as the settings had been adjusted past the presets.

The place it fell barely behind was in the way in which some higher mids and high-end bleed got here by way of as soon as compression and EQ had been added again in. It was refined, very refined, nevertheless noticeable sufficient in context. In comparison with Oxford, Professional-G felt a contact brighter and rather less managed within the suppressed bleed. Oxford appeared to maintain issues barely darker and extra subdued in a method that felt extra pure as soon as the remainder of the processing chain was energetic.

Nonetheless, this was splitting hairs.

Professional-G was wonderful, and if any individual informed me they had been utilizing it as their go-to drum gate, I’d utterly perceive why.

3. sonible sensible:gate, Intelligent and Very Succesful

Sonible sensible:gate was one of the vital attention-grabbing plugins within the take a look at due to its AI-assisted method.

It completely labored. In reality, at occasions it obtained remarkably near Oxford. On the kick, it did a powerful job and felt musical as soon as the discharge and assault had been dialled in correctly. On the snare, it was additionally able to lowering bleed considerably, particularly with some cautious tweaking of the suppression controls.

The problem with sensible:gate was that whereas it cleaned issues up nicely, I felt it misplaced a bit of of the snare’s physique in comparison with Oxford. It additionally allowed a small quantity of high-end bleed by way of in a method that might really feel a bit of brittle as soon as the compression and EQ had been introduced again in.

That stated, it was nonetheless actually good. Excellent, the truth is.

This was not a case of 1 plugin succeeding and one other failing. This was a case of a number of very succesful instruments all doing the job, with refined variations in really feel, tone, and workflow. sensible:gate completely belongs in that dialog.

 

4. SSL X-Gate, Reasonably priced and Filled with Character

SSL X-Gate was the most affordable plugin within the take a look at, and for the cash it was genuinely spectacular.

This isn’t probably the most feature-rich choice. It’s easy, direct, and intensely simple to rise up and operating. There’s something refreshing about that. My mind likes a format like this. No fuss, no overthinking, simply threshold, assault, maintain, launch, and go.

On the kick, it was surprisingly tasty. It introduced in a punchy, assertive assault and gave a consequence that felt vigorous and musical. On the snare, it was much less pure than the highest contenders, nevertheless it did one thing attention-grabbing. It modified the sound in a method that was really fairly interesting, notably in case you are after that traditional gated SSL-style rock sound.

That turned the primary story with the SSL. It was not probably the most clear plugin within the shootout. It didn’t protect the unique snare physique in addition to Oxford, Professional-G, and even sensible:gate. Nonetheless, it had character. It reshaped the sound in a method that felt deliberate and helpful.

If I had been chasing a extra 80s-inspired drum sound, particularly on rock tracks, I’d completely attain for it.

So no, it was not probably the most pure. Nonetheless, it might be probably the most vibey.

5. Black Salt Audio Silencer, The Shock Contender

Silencer might have entered this take a look at with the bottom expectations, nevertheless it ended up being one of many greatest surprises.

It’s unbelievably easy. Probably the best gate plugin I’ve ever used. That alone will make it enticing to a whole lot of mixers. You should not have to spend ages fiddling about. You get in, make just a few choices, and get a consequence shortly.

On the kick, it was extraordinarily aggressive. In reality, it ended up vying for second place on kick alone. It managed bleed nicely, averted a number of the harsher high-end artefacts that confirmed up elsewhere, and obtained very near the Oxford in total really feel.

Its major limitation was maintain. I stored wanting only a tiny bit extra size on the kick. Not loads, only a fraction extra. On the snare, it was additionally very spectacular, though it turned a bit of trickier when the half moved past an easy backbeat into extra detailed fills or ghosted materials. After I adjusted it to deal with the extra complicated bits, it was not all the time fairly as flattering on the primary snare sound.

Nonetheless, I got here away way more impressed than I anticipated.

For quick, efficient drum cleanup, particularly in heavier types, Silencer might be a really robust selection.

What Really Separated Them?

The fascinating a part of this shootout was simply how shut these plugins actually had been.

None of them had been unhealthy. None of them embarrassed themselves. Fairly the other. The largest takeaway was how good drum gating instruments have turn out to be.

The variations got here down to a couple key issues:

Naturalness Oxford persistently preserved the unique tone and physique of the drums higher than the remaining.

Bleed suppression Professional-G, sensible:gate, and Silencer all obtained shut, nevertheless Oxford nonetheless had the sting in how easily it handled the remaining bleed.

Character SSL modified the sound extra noticeably, nevertheless in a method that might be creatively helpful.

Workflow Silencer was by far the quickest and easiest. SSL was additionally splendidly easy.

Additional options Oxford’s time alignment perform was an enormous benefit in a multi-mic state of affairs like this.

That final level actually mattered. As soon as the overhead, room, and trash mic had been aligned with the kick and snare, the whole drum sound turned greater and extra strong. That’s not simply comfort. That could be a significant sonic profit.

 

Remaining Rating

On this specific shootout, utilizing this specific 5 mic drum recording, my rating got here out like this:

1. Sonnox Oxford Drum Gate Finest total mixture of pure gating, physique preservation, flexibility, and time alignment.

2. FabFilter Professional-G Exceptionally shut, particularly on pure gating, with nice management and suppleness.

3. Black Salt Audio Silencer / sonible sensible:gate Very aggressive, every with completely different strengths. Silencer for simplicity and pace, sensible:gate for clever cleanup.

5. SSL X-Gate Nonetheless excellent, particularly for the value, and stuffed with character, nevertheless much less pure than the others.

That stated, rating them virtually feels unfair as a result of they’re all genuinely robust instruments. This was much less about exposing weaknesses and extra about understanding the place every one shines.

 

So Which One Ought to You Purchase?

That will depend on what you want.

In order for you probably the most full drum cleanup software, particularly for tough multi-mic recordings, Oxford Drum Gate is the clear winner right here. The gating is great, and the time alignment pushes it into a unique class.

If you happen to already personal Professional-G, you could be nearer to the highest consequence than you assume. This can be very succesful.

If pace and ease matter most, Silencer is a severe contender.

If you happen to like intelligent AI-assisted workflows, sensible:gate may be very spectacular.

In order for you character, punch, and affordability, SSL X-Gate is a whole lot of enjoyable.

In different phrases, there is no such thing as a unhealthy choice right here. There may be merely the fitting choice in your workflow, your price range, and your music.
